Dungeons and dragons expert set (1983 pdf). The included adventure, X1-The Isle of Dread, was an excellent introduction to wilderness adverturing (both on land and at sea). Between 19 this system was revised and expanded by Mentzer as a series of five boxed sets, including the Basic Rules, Expert Rules (supporting character levels 4 through 14), 7 Companion Rules (supporting levels 15 through 25), 8 Master Rules (supporting levels 26 through 36), 9 and Immortal Rules (supporting Immortals charact. It includes information and stat blocks for monsters, advice for building combat encounters, and magic items.Format: box, 64 page rules book, X1-The Isle of Dread, dice, crayonĬomments: This boxed set was designed to take Classical D&D character frojm 4th to 14th level and introduce wilderness adventuring to players and dungeonmasters.
